Russia presents "new evidence" in Crimea case
An Oschadbank branch in Luhansk, Ukraine (Credit: Wikimedia Commons)
Russia has asked an UNCITRAL tribunal to revise a US$1.1 billion treaty award compensating a Ukrainian state-owned bank for the expropriation of its assets in Crimea, saying the claimant withheld evidence that would have led to the claim being thrown out.
